Auxiliary Nursing and Midwifery (ANM) is a certificate-level course in the field of medical nursing. The duration of the ANM course varies from institute to institute. The course provides knowledge about fields of medicine, healthcare, and providing medical assistant to families, individuals, society, and measures necessary for maintaining a good quality of life.
It is a profession that is mainly involved in maternity care and assistance to new mothers during their pregnancy period and works. ANM covers a wide range of subject areas such as Microbiology, Biological Science, Anatomy, Physiology, Sociology, Fundamentals of Nursing, Behavioral Science, and First Aid. It is the right career choice for the candidates who are determined and have skills like flexibility, tenacity, and observation skills which are crucial to good nursing.

Auxiliary Nursing and Midwifery (ANM) Eligibility Criteria
Minimum Qualification Required: 10+ 2 with science as a mandatory stream.
Minimum Marks Required: 50%
Age Requirement: The minimum age requirement is 17 years and the maximum age for the course should not be more than 35 years.
ANM Admission Process:
Admission for the ANM program is on the basis of candidates' performance in the common entrance exams. Few colleges also provide direct admission based on the student's marks in class 12th.
The Direct Admission process for the ANM course is followed by a majority of colleges in India. Candidates are selected on the basis of their marks scored in the Intermediate examination. After the board results are out, the colleges will release their cut-off scores. If candidates have scored more than or equal to the cut-off scores of the intended college, they will be eligible for enrollment at that institute.
Merit Admissions:
The second way for the admission of the candidate to the ANM course is done on the basis of the entrance exam. In this pathway, candidates are selected on the basis of their marks scored in the entrance examinations of an institute.
